After years of work as samplers and electronic textures operator in the famous French live dub band Kaly Live Dub, Stephane Bernard aka Uzul decided to launch his own hiphop indus live project 
Uzul prod. His influences varying from roots and old school dub to lo-fi, noise and the massive 
Indus electronic music from the likes of Techno Animal or Scorn. 
Whom he shared a tour with made his music a subtle mix of all kind of massive electronic musics. 
Being constantly watching for vibes traveling from other countries. 
Uzul discovered Dubstep and felt in love for its huge sound and sub-frequencies focus. His true live performances shooting Dubstep into live unexplored areas gave him much respect from the heavyweights in the scene such as Skream who did a remix for his “Under Pressure E.P.” on 
Dub technic in 2009

Travelling Without Moving, premier album d’Uzul Prod, est un disque qui se visite, un véritable carnet de voyage sonore. C’est aussi une rencontre entre plusieurs styles, une confrontation entre le dub et le trip-hop, les machines et les musiques dites « traditionnelles ». A l’origine du projet, Stéphane (alias Uzul), homme-machine de Kaly Live Dub et du collectif Hybrid Sound System, qui décide de laisser libre court à ses inspirations évasives et à ses expérimentations nouvelles. Pour y parvenir, il s’accompagne de Tit’o (Picore) à la guitare et à la voix et de NicoTico (XLR Project, Hybrid Sound System) à la création vidéo. A ce trio charismatique viennent également s’ajouter d’autres contributions : la chanteuse russe Dasha, MC Razamike, la formation dub Sopot, MC Carbon Copies et le violoniste Vinchenzo. Travelling Without Moving est donc une aventure à la fois artistique et humaine, une collaboration entre plusieurs musiciens de talent.
